WebAnatomy of Colon and Rectum The entire colon is about 5 feet (150 cm) long, and is divided into five major segments. The rectum is the last anatomic segment before the anus. The ascending and descending colon are supported by peritoneal folds called mesentery. WebAnatomically connecting the ileum and ascending colon via the ileocecal valve, the cecum receives digested chyme with intestinal fluid and begins to absorb water and other nutrition physiologically 1). Therefore, it is anatomically and physiologically a transition site for digestive function.

WebThe colon is divided into four parts: the ascending, transverse, descendingand sigmoid. The ascending and transverse colon meet at the right hepatic flexure(near the liver). The transverse and descending colon meet at the left splenic flexure(near the spleen). The large intestine has three bands of longitudinal muscle fibers called taeniae coli.
